The Otis Bulldogs just played yesterday, but they'll still head out to face the Genoa-Hugo/Karval Pirates at 2:00 p.m. on Saturday. Given that the two teams suffered a loss in their last games, they both have a little extra motivation heading into this match.
On Friday, Otis was within striking distance but couldn't close the gap as they fell 51-47 to Flagler.
Meanwhile, Genoa-Hugo/Karval lost 37-14 to Eads on Thursday. While losing is never fun, the Pirates can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Colorado basketball rankings (they are ranked 156th, while the Eagles are ranked 38th).
Genoa-Hugo/Karval's defeat dropped their record down to 9-11. As for Otis, their loss dropped their record down to 9-8.
Otis strolled past Genoa-Hugo/Karval in their previous matchup back in February of 2024 by a score of 42-28. The rematch might be a little tougher for Otis since the team won't have the home-court adv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
